Introduction to Hands-Free Technology
Hands-free technology refers to any device, system, or method that allows users to perform tasks or interact with devices without the need to physically hold or touch them. This can range from voice-controlled assistants and Bluetooth headsets to more advanced technologies like gesture recognition systems and smart home devices. The primary goal of hands-free technology is to provide users with more flexibility and convenience, allowing them to multitask and reduce the risk of accidents or injuries associated with manual operation.

Key Milestones in Hands-Free Technology
The development of hands-free technology has been marked by several key milestones, including the introduction of the first Bluetooth headset in 1998 and the launch of Apple’s Siri in 2011. These innovations have paved the way for the creation of more sophisticated hands-free devices and systems, such as smartwatches, fitness trackers, and augmented reality (AR) glasses. Benefits of Using Hands-Free Technology
The benefits of using hands-free technology are numerous and well-documented. Some of the most significant advantages include:
- Enhanced Safety: By minimizing the need for manual operation, hands-free technology can significantly reduce the risk of accidents and injuries. This is particularly important in situations where the use of hands is critical, such as driving or operating heavy machinery.
- Increased Productivity: Hands-free technology enables users to multitask more efficiently, allowing them to perform multiple tasks simultaneously without compromising on safety or productivity.
- Improved Accessibility: Hands-free devices and systems can be particularly beneficial for individuals with disabilities, providing them with greater independence and autonomy in their daily lives.

Tips for Effective Hands-Free Communication
Effective communication is critical when using hands-free technology, particularly in situations where clarity and accuracy are essential. Some tips for effective hands-free communication include:
- Speaking Clearly and Concisely: Enunciate your words and speak at a moderate pace to ensure that your voice is recognized accurately by the device.
- Minimizing Background Noise: Reduce background noise and distractions to improve the quality of your voice signal and prevent misinterpretation.
- Using Natural Language: Use natural language and everyday phrases to interact with your device, making it easier to communicate and access information.

How can I ensure my hands-free device is secure and private?
Ensuring the security and privacy of hands-free devices is crucial, especially when using them for sensitive activities such as online banking, shopping, or communicating with others. One way to ensure security is to use devices with robust encryption and secure connectivity protocols, such as Bluetooth or Wi-Fi. Additionally, individuals should regularly update their device’s software and firmware to patch any security vulnerabilities. It is also essential to use strong passwords, enable two-factor authentication, and be cautious when connecting to public Wi-Fi networks or unknown devices.
Moreover, individuals should be mindful of their device’s data collection and sharing practices. For example, some hands-free devices may collect and store personal data, such as voice recordings, location information, or browsing history. It is essential to review the device’s privacy policy, understand what data is being collected, and adjust the device’s settings to minimize data sharing. By taking these precautions and being aware of potential security risks, individuals can protect their personal data and ensure the secure use of their hands-free devices.
Can hands-free devices be used by people with disabilities?
Yes, hands-free devices can be highly beneficial for people with disabilities, particularly those with mobility or dexterity impairments. For instance, individuals with arthritis, paralysis, or other conditions that affect hand or finger movement can use hands-free devices to communicate, access information, or control their environment. Many hands-free devices, such as voice-controlled assistants or smart home devices, can be operated using voice commands, making them accessible to individuals with limited mobility. Additionally, some devices offer specialized features, such as text-to-speech or speech-to-text functionality, that can assist individuals with visual or hearing impairments.
Moreover, hands-free devices can be customized to meet the specific needs of individuals with disabilities. For example, some devices offer adjustable font sizes, high contrast modes, or customizable button layouts that can facilitate use for individuals with visual impairments. Similarly, devices with advanced speech recognition technology can be trained to recognize individual voices, accents, or languages, making them more accessible to people with speech or language disorders. By leveraging hands-free technology, individuals with disabilities can gain greater independence, accessibility, and inclusivity in their daily lives.
How can I troubleshoot common issues with my hands-free device?
Troubleshooting common issues with hands-free devices can be straightforward, and individuals can often resolve problems by following simple steps. For instance, if a device is not connecting to a phone or computer, individuals can try restarting the device, checking the Bluetooth or Wi-Fi connection, or updating the device’s software. If a device is experiencing audio issues, such as poor sound quality or dropped calls, individuals can try adjusting the volume, checking for firmware updates, or resetting the device to its factory settings. It is also essential to consult the user manual or manufacturer’s website for troubleshooting guides and FAQs.
In some cases, hands-free devices may require more advanced troubleshooting, such as resetting the device, performing a factory reset, or contacting the manufacturer’s support team. Individuals can also try searching online for solutions or consulting with technical experts to resolve more complex issues. By being patient, persistent, and proactive, individuals can troubleshoot common issues with their hands-free devices and enjoy uninterrupted use. Additionally, regular maintenance, such as cleaning the device, updating software, and backing up data, can help prevent issues and ensure optimal device performance.
